What specific eye care services should I expect from an optometrist in the Dubois County area near Eckerty?
Optometrists in the communities surrounding Eckerty typically offer comprehensive eye exams, prescriptions for glasses and contact lenses, diagnosis and management of conditions like dry eye, glaucoma, and diabetic eye disease. Given the rural setting, many also provide pre- and post-operative care for cataract surgery performed at regional surgical centers. It's common for these practices to have an optical shop on-site for convenient eyewear fitting and repairs.
Do optometrists near Eckerty, IN accept my vision or medical insurance?
Most optometry practices in the Huntingburg and Jasper area accept a wide range of insurance plans common to Southern Indiana, including Medicare, Medicaid (Hoosier Healthwise), and major providers like Anthem, UnitedHealthcare, and EyeMed. However, due to the variety of plans, it's crucial to call the specific office before your appointment. Verify they are in-network for your vision plan and confirm what your coverage includes for exams, frames, and lenses.
What should I consider when choosing between the optometrists available in the towns near Eckerty?
When choosing an optometrist in this region, consider proximity to Eckerty, office hours that fit your schedule, and whether they offer emergency services for eye injuries or infections. Look for practices with modern diagnostic technology, which is important for comprehensive care. Reading local online reviews or asking for personal recommendations from Eckerty residents can provide insight into bedside manner and patient satisfaction. Also, check if they specialize in any specific needs you have, such as pediatric eye care or managing ocular diseases common in an aging population.
How far in advance do I typically need to book an eye exam with an optometrist serving the Eckerty community?
Appointment availability can vary. For a routine comprehensive exam with a popular optometrist in Jasper or Huntingburg, you might need to schedule 2-4 weeks in advance, especially for evening or Saturday appointments. For more urgent but non-emergency issues (like a sudden prescription change or eye infection), many practices keep slots open for same-week or next-day visits. New patient appointments may also require more lead time. It's advisable to call early, particularly if you need an exam to meet a deadline for a driver's license or work requirement.
